Official blazon
Spanish Escudo medio partido y cortado. 1º de plata tres flechas de gules puestas en palo. 2º de sinople haz de tres espigas de oro. 3º De gules tres casas de oro surmontadas de una corona real abierta de lo mismo. Al timbre corona real cerrada.
English blazon wanted

Origin/meaning

The arms were officially granted on July 12, 2006.
